04-07-2004, 02:41 PM
I have got a very mean task to deliver.

consider i have the following data:

class_id object_id date_val name
455 1 9-4-2004 Datum_start_behandeltermijn
455 1 19-4-2004 Datum_beslissing
455 2 19-4-2004 Datum_start_behandeltermijn
455 2 1-5-2004 Datum_beslissing

but for each unique combination of class_id and object_id there can be more name value pairs as records in this database

what i would like to transform this into is:

class_id object_id Datum_start_behandeltermijn Datum_beslissing
455 1 9-4-2004 19-4-2004
455 2 19-4-2004 1-5-2004

each record in the original table holds a name and a value of a data-element
what i want is the name of the element to become a column-name in the transformed table where the value is in this column
does anyone know enough SQL statements to perform this transformation

this is needed to produce management information


04-08-2004, 01:23 PM
it was a mean beast, but i finally found the way to do it, thanks for the thinking some of you did. :rolleyes:

04-08-2004, 02:02 PM
You're welcome.

I got to the part where i needed to know which db-format you used :rolleyes:

04-08-2004, 02:57 PM
solution is db-independent, just some plain old joins and where clauses

04-08-2004, 03:16 PM
Which is almost the most efficient way :rolleyes: